UFC returns to T-Mobile Arena in Las Vegas on March 8 with a blockbuster light heavyweight championship tilt that sees Alex Pereira defend against No. 1 ranked contender Magomed Ankalaev in the headliner.
Pereira (12-2, fighting out of Danbury, Conn. by way of Sao Paulo, Brazil) aims for his fourth successful title defense. A devastating knockout artist, he has delivered thrilling finishes against Khalil Rountree Jr., Jiri Prochazka and Jamahal Hill. Pereira now hopes to continue his run atop the 205-pound division by handing Ankalaev his first KO loss.

Ankalaev (20-1-1 1NC, fighting out of Makhachkala, Russia) plans to capitalize on his second UFC championship opportunity. Currently riding a 13-fight unbeaten streak, he has earned notable victories over Aleksandar Rakic, Anthony Smith and Volkan Oezdemir. Ankalaev now aims to dethrone Pereira and achieve his dream of capturing UFC gold.
Also on the UFC 313: Pereira vs. Ankalaev card, No. 3 ranked lightweight contender Justin Gaethje battles No. 6 Dan Hooker in a five round co-main event guaranteed to deliver fireworks.
Former interim lightweight titleholder Gaethje (26-5, fighting out of Denver, Colo. by way of Safford, Ariz.) looks to kick off his 2025 season with another highlight performance. Among the most exciting fighters in UFC history, he holds memorable KO wins against Dustin Poirier, Tony Ferguson and Donald Cerrone. Gaethje now intends to defend his spot in the rankings by stopping Hooker in emphatic fashion.
Hooker (24-12, fighting out of Auckland, New Zealand) plans to steal the show to continue his climb up the lightweight ladder. A dynamic finisher currently riding a three-fight win streak, he holds thrilling victories over Jalin Turner, Gilbert Burns and Paul Felder. Hooker now hopes to secure the biggest win of his career and crack the Top 5 rankings.
UFC 313: Pereira vs. Ankalaev takes place Saturday, March 8 in Las Vegas, Nevada with the main card at 10 PM ET/7 PM PT on ESPN+ PPV. The prelims will be available on ESPNEWS and ESPN Deportes, as well as simulcast in English and Spanish on ESPN+, at 8 PM ET/5 PM PT. The early prelims will kick off at 6 PM ET/3 PM PT on ESPN+ and UFC Fight Pass.
